Subject: On-call heads-up — Orchardly catalog cache. Welcome aboard. The main gotcha: catalog price updates invalidate by SKU, but bundle pages cache composite keys, so a stale bundle can outlive its parts. If support reports wrong bundle prices, purge the composite namespace first. We'll cover this at the weekly sync; the invalidation playbook is on this internal page.

wiki page, yagef-tawif: https://sentry.lumicdata.local/view/merge_requests/pipeline/merge_requests/e08f7f35c80b5755

## Build Provenance: Log Sampling — Fenwick Relay

Fenwick Relay emits ~40k log lines/min. Provenance builds sample at 1:500 to keep attestation artifacts under the 10MB cap. Sampling seed is fixed per release so reruns are reproducible. Do not raise the rate without updating the retention policy in Corvid Archive first.

Release managers: verify the sampled bundle was signed by the Harbinger pipeline before cutting the tag. The signing step stamps the provenance record with the token below.

pipeline stamp: htk3_69f

Runbook: Account Recovery during Replica Lag

When the Dovetail read-replica lag alarm fires, account recovery lookups may return stale data. Switch the support console to primary-read mode before verifying identity. Do not approve resets against replica data. To enable primary-read mode in the Harkness console, enter the recovery passphrase below.

unlock words, fadug-tageg: zorix-wenwyn-quenmir

Subject: Inkwell markdown pipeline 5.1 deployed

On-call: the Inkwell rendering pipeline is now on 5.1 in production. Changes: sanitizer runs before the table parser, footnote rendering is cached per document, and the fallback plain-text path no longer strips headings. If render latency alarms fire, roll back via the standard script — it handles cache invalidation. Known issue: nested blockquotes over six levels render flat. The deployment trace token follows.

build token for hawep-kageg: htk14_558814e2114cc7

Ticket: Staging env misconfigured for Siftgate bloom filter

The bloom layer in front of the Pellet KV store is rejecting all lookups in staging because the env file was copied from the dev template without credentials. False-positive tuning values are fine; only the auth line is missing. To unblock the weekly demo, the Pellet admission secret must be set on the following line.

env line for yaguf-fajop: LEDGER_TOKEN13=fb08984397349